About this Role

This is a key role and will involve working closely with the SENCo, SEND and Pastoral Teams as well as external agencies and traded services to ensure that students with Special Educational Needs and groups of students requiring additional support receive the highest possible standards of care and education with a student-centred approach so that they are ready and successful for life beyond secondary school.

 

The successful candidate will be committed to support the SENCo with providing equal opportunities for all students with SEND and additional needs, removing obstacles to their progress and wellbeing, ensuring each child gets the support they need to achieve their full potential.

 

This is a key position and involves working closely with staff, students and their families, supporting students in school and working with external agencies.

 

The successful candidate will be passionate about improving the outcomes for students and will have:

  • A good understanding of secondary special educational needs and additional needs which affect our students’ cognitive processing and wellbeing.
  • Knowledge and understanding of the barriers faced by students with SEND and additional needs.
  • Excellent interpersonal, communication and planning skills.
  • Excellent organisational and ICT skills.
  • Passionate and committed to inclusion, diversity, and equality.
